The Giant Buddha of Leshan is a statue carved out of a cliff face in Sichuan, China. It is one of the largest Buddha statues in the world and has become a popular tourist attraction.

Key Features

  • Carved out of a cliff face
  • Over 71 meters tall
  • Built during the Tang Dynasty
  • Located at the confluence of three rivers
